Spider-Man: Homecoming

First Published:

After bursting onto the screen in Captain America: Civil War, Tom Holland gets a movie all to himself in Spider-Man: Homecoming. Jon Watts (Cop Car) directs the first film in the second reboot of the franchise in the last five years. Joining Holland in the cast are Michael Keaton, Jon Favreau, Zendaya, Donald Glover, Tyne Daly, Marisa Tomei, and Robert Downey Jr.

Thrilled by his experience with the Avengers, Peter returns home, where he lives with his Aunt May (Tomei), under the watchful eye of his new mentor Tony Stark (Downey Jr.). Peter tries to fall back into his normal daily routine – distracted by thoughts of proving himself to be more than just your friendly neighborhood Spider-Man – but when the Vulture (Keaton) emerges as a new villain, everything that Peter holds most important will be threatened. Peter may be young, with the everyday pressures of any teenager, but his moment has arrived as he is challenged to become the hero he is meant to be.

“Peter goes from having the time of his life battling with the Avengers in Civil War to suddenly being back to riding the subway to school. He feels like he’s got nothing to do,” says Holland. “Tony Stark has assigned him to be the friendly neighborhood Spider-Man, which means helping get cats out of trees, helping old ladies across the street and stopping petty thieves – nothing too hairy. But then Spider-Man stumbles across high-tech weapons, which leads him down a path of learning and mastering his new abilities and powers.”

Spider-Man: Homecoming is rated PG.
